3-(3,4-Dimethoxyphenyl)propan-1-ol (cas: 3929-47-3) belongs to ethers. Ether is less polar than esters, alcohols or amines because of the oxygen atom that is unable to participate in hydrogen bonding due to the presence of bulky alkyl groups on both sides of the oxygen atom. But ether is more polar than alkenes. At room temperature, ethers are pleasant-smelling colourless liquids. Relative to alcohols, ethers are generally less dense, are less soluble in water, and have lower boiling points. They are relatively unreactive, and as a result they are useful as solvents for fats, oils, waxes, perfumes, resins, dyes, gums, and hydrocarbons. Musk strawberries: the flavour of a formerly famous fruit reassessed was written by Pet’ka, Jan;Leitner, Erich;Parameswaran, Baskaran. And the article was included in Flavour and Fragrance Journal in 2012.Synthetic Route of C11H16O3 This article mentions the following:

Fruits of wildly growing and naturally ripened musk strawberries (Fragaria moschata) from two highland sites were studied during two seasons. The fruits were characterized on site by two flavourists and a full profile of the volatile compounds was extracted immediately after collection using solid phase extraction and analyzed by gas chromatog.-mass spectrometry (GC-MS) and gas chromatog.-olfactometry (GC-O). The aroma of whole fruits was characterized with dynamic headspace coupled to GC-MS. Single fruits evaluated on site were characterized by green, spicy, seedy and sweet exotic notes, while the fruit bunches showed a complex tropical smell. More than 100 distinctive volatile compounds were detected by GC-MS. Some of them are reported for the first time in the Fragaria species, most notably the abundant coniferyl alc. GC-O revealed that mesifuran, eugenol, Me butyrate, furaneol and 3-mercaptohexyl acetate were the key components of the highland musk strawberry flavor. A comparison of the volatile pattern with the much more known woodland strawberry (F. vesca) from a nearby location contrasted the differences in the volatile composition of the musk strawberry. Repeated anal. of fruits harvested 2 years after the first vintage confirmed these data. Copyright © 2012 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.
